The day dawned bright and clear. After a simple breakfast in the garden, I motored Claire over to the island of Burano. I thought she’d fall in love with the lace, which had made the island famous. But beyond that, I knew she’d appreciate the colorful houses. Blue next to pink next to yellow next to orange.

I told her the history of the island on the way over, but in truth, I was not myself. I hadn’t slept at all, thanks to Jacopo, as my conscience warred with itself. Yes, I should tell her everything she didn’t know. But how much did the truth matter? Did it matter enough to not only ruin this weekend, but also her lingering love for her late husband?

But he didn’t deserve her devotion. Didn’t deserve it while he was alive, why should he have it for eternity?

But I didn’t deserve it either.

But I wanted it.

But what if I also wanted to tell her? Who I really am. The man hiding in the shadow of the fantasy. Then what? I wanted to keep talking about art and sex. But what if I also wanted to talk about dreams and desires, vulnerabilities, pain and longing? And, most frighteningly, the future?

No.

Better to leave the magic intact. Keep the magician intact.

Once again, what I wanted was the problem. The fact that I wanted anything at all was the problem.

We disembarked and I led her to a small lace shop. Everyone in this lagoon was a friend of my uncle’s, but guests were only brought to those who made quality products. This shop had been in the same family practically since lace was invented, and the current proprietor was the daughter of two of Jacopo’s best friends, Silvia and Luigi. She took her time explaining the craft to Claire, who, as with the palazzo, or the gondola workshop (or anything else she gave her attention to), had a wealth of questions. In the end, she pulled out her wallet and bought two lace placemats for two-hundred-fifty euro. She saw me watching. “It’s okay. I withdrew a grand from the company account before I left. Just in case.”

“In case what?” I teased. “In case I never picked you up at the airport?”

She grinned. But then she asked for them to be gift-wrapped.

We left the shop and I couldn’t help but ask, “A gift?”

“Don’t be jealous. They’re for Jacopo.”

“This is not a jealous why…but why?”

“For his boat.”

“That’s a lovely gesture, but if she’d known they were for Jacopo she would have given you a family discount.” I started walking back to the shop.

Claire’s hand landed on my forearm, tugging me to a stop. “That’s why I didn’t tell her. Let her make her money. Please. It’s my pleasure. Don’t refuse me my pleasure.”

Her mind was made up. I had to admit: there was something I liked about that. “At the very least, he doesn’t need two.”

“Maybe not right now. But who knows? Right?”

I’d never imagined him having a partnered life. I’d never even thought to ask him if he wanted that.
